ActionAnnouncer is a Java server plugin designed to display configurable messages in Minecraft’s action bar, the area above the hotbar. It can show a welcome announcement when players join, rotate messages at set intervals in ordered or random mode, or send a timed message to one player or everyone online through commands.
Administrators can add, remove, edit, start, stop, and reload announcements in game. The plugin also offers an API for integrations and supports %player% and %online% by default, with many more dynamic values available through PlaceholderAPI.
